Yugha's Philosophy on Building Software
Yugha believes that most software fails not because of bad code, but because of bad systems thinking. He approaches every project with three questions:
- What is the one job this product does? — Feature creep kills more products than technical debt.
- What breaks first under load? — Designing for failure modes from day one saves months of firefighting later.
- Can a non-technical user understand this? — If the UX requires a manual, the UX is wrong.
